Pool deck drainage problems in Florida are a leading cause of surface deterioration, cracking, and premature structural damage. Many homeowners focus on visible cracks or stains without realizing that improper water management beneath and around the pool deck is often the root issue.
Florida’s frequent rain, high water table, and sandy soil create challenging conditions for concrete surfaces. When water is not directed away properly, it saturates the base layer, weakens support, and accelerates surface failure.
Understanding how drainage affects pool deck performance allows homeowners to address problems early and avoid costly reconstruction.
Why Drainage Is Critical for Pool Decks in Florida
Drainage plays a structural role, not just a cosmetic one. In Florida, water accumulation leads to:
- Soil erosion beneath slabs
- Base instability
- Increased hydrostatic pressure
- Surface cracking and settlement
- Mold and algae growth
Pool deck drainage problems in Florida often develop slowly, making them easy to overlook until damage becomes extensive.
Common Signs of Pool Deck Drainage Problems
Homeowners should watch for warning signs such as:
- Standing water after rain
- Water pooling near pool edges
- Uneven or sunken deck sections
- Cracks spreading in multiple directions
- Algae or mildew buildup
- Soft or eroding soil near the slab
These symptoms indicate that water is not being properly redirected away from the deck.
What Causes Pool Deck Drainage Problems in Florida
Improper Deck Slope
Pool decks must be sloped correctly to move water away from the pool and home foundation. Even minor slope errors can cause pooling.
Soil Saturation
Florida’s sandy soil absorbs water quickly but loses stability when saturated, leading to settlement beneath the slab.
Blocked or Missing Drainage Channels
Deck drains or expansion joints may be clogged, damaged, or improperly installed.
Outdated Construction Methods
Older pool decks often lack modern drainage planning suited to Florida’s current rainfall patterns.
Pool deck drainage problems in Florida are rarely caused by a single factor — they result from combined design and environmental issues.
How Drainage Issues Damage Pool Deck Surfaces
Poor drainage directly affects surface integrity:
- Water penetrates through micro-cracks
- Moisture weakens bonding materials
- Expansion and contraction intensify
- Surface spalling increases
- Structural cracks widen
Once moisture reaches the base, surface repairs alone are no longer sufficient.
Drainage Correction vs Surface Repair
Surface repair without drainage correction is temporary. Homeowners often make the mistake of fixing cracks without addressing water flow.
Surface Repair Alone
- Short-term improvement
- Cracks often return
- Base issues remain
Drainage Correction + Repair
- Long-term durability
- Stable base conditions
- Reduced future cracking
Pool deck drainage problems in Florida must be corrected at the source to prevent repeat damage.
Professional Solutions for Pool Deck Drainage Problems in Florida
Slope Adjustment
Regrading or resurfacing corrects improper water flow across the deck.
Drainage Channel Installation
Linear drains or perimeter drainage systems redirect water efficiently.
Base Stabilization
Soil compaction and reinforcement reduce movement beneath the slab.
Surface Resurfacing
Once drainage is corrected, resurfacing restores a seamless, durable finish.
A combined approach delivers the best long-term results.
